Charming Prince George steals limelight at wedding after showing off his marching in his pageboy outfit

He caused hysterics as he paraded about in smart white shirt and blue shorts.

While he stuck to his pageboy role with military precision, his sister took a little more convincing.

Princess Charlotte didn’t share her brother’s enthusiasm for their special role, as the flower-girl nervously clutched a bouquet.

She appeared shy dressed in a pretty white smock dress with ruffled collar in a series of adorable photos of the young royals.

The prince and princess took on their starring duties cheered by proud parents the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ge.



One snap shows impish George, five, gazing over his shoulder at photographers as he clutched his mother’s hand.

In another group shot Kate lovingly cradled three-year-old Charlotte in her arms.

The royals mingled with other guests at the posh wedding of Sophie Carter and Robert Snuggs, close friends of Kate, at St Andrew’s Episcopal Church in Letheringsett, Norfolk.

George and Charlotte were chosen to be among the three bridesmaids and four page boys taking part in the ceremony.



They all wore outfits from Amaia Kids – one of Kate’s favourite childrenswear labels.

One royal watcher said of the young prince: “George was having a great time, running around like the leader of the pack.

“He was loving his responsibility and played up to the crowd. At one point everyone chuckled as he began marching about.

“Charlotte wasn’t enjoying being the centre of attention quite so much.”



The young royals have taken on the roles of bridesmaid and page boy twice before, during the wedding of Meghan Markle and Prince Harry in May, and at the nuptials of Pippa Middleton and James Matthews in 2017.

For Saturday’s celebration, mum Kate wore a striking blue dress, and dad William was seen wearing a traditional tailcoat.

Also in attendance were Kate’s parents, Carole and Michael Middleton, along with the Duchess’s brother, James Middleton.

Pippa Middleton was notably absent, likely due to the fact she is expecting her first child next month.




Kate has been close friends with Ms Carter for years. The duo were first spotted together at Wimbledon in 2008.

Ms Carter was also named one of Princess Charlotte’s godparents ahead of her christening in 2015.

She is reported to have close Royal connections, and once dated Thomas van Straubenzee, a close friend of Prince William.
